Biography

Elias Vasquez is a Los Angeles-based drummer and percussionist with over two decades of experience across live performance, touring, and studio recording. Rooted in Ventura County, he attended the Jazz Performance Program at Cal State Northridge. He's built a career performing and recording across a wide range of genres — Rock, Jazz, Funk, R&B, and Afro-Cuban.

His performance credits include the Hollywood Bowl's Playboy Jazz Festival, Disney Concert Hall with the LA Philharmonic, and international touring and recording alongside artists such as Big Bad Voodoo Daddy, Cody Simpson, Postmodern Jukebox, and MIYAVI. He studied under some of the most respected names in the drumming world — Gregg Bissonette, Alex Acuña, Gene Coye, and Walfredo Reyes Jr. — and remains an endorsed artist with Istanbul Mehmet Cymbals.

Elias serves as Staff Instructor at Drum Channel, where he teaches, creates drum transcriptions, and contributes to course production alongside some of the industry's top players.
